A set of lug nuts could secure a wheel to threaded wheel studs and an automobile’s axles. You should install the lug nuts in an alternating pattern, generally referred to as a star pattern. It ensures a uniform distribution of load throughout the wheel mounting floor. When installing lug nuts, tighten them with a calibrated torque wrench. Both car and wheel manufacturers present recommended torque values when an installation. Failure to abide by the recommended torque value may damage the wheel and brake rotor/drum.

Lug nuts may be difficult to remove, as they may get stuck to the wheel stud. In such cases, utilize a breaker bar or repeated blows from an impact wrench. Alternating between tightening and loosening can free especially stubborn lug nuts. When attaching a car’s wheels, torque is the amount of pressure applied to a lug nut when tightening it. Your vehicle requires specific torque to keep the wheels in place.
Unbalanced wheels: Too little torque may be just as dangerous as too much. The wobbling can loosen the lug nuts till the wheel falls off the automobile.
